Real-time Object Database / Process / Event / Alarm Management / History
At the heart of the RTAP SCADA platform is an object oriented real-time database that provides the flexibility and openness to address the most demanding industry challenges. In many industries such as water, oil & gas, transportation and power the scale and diversity of assets is increasing rapidly. This increasing asset mix coupled with more demanding regulatory requirements and changing competitive environments are pushing the capabilities of monitoring and control systems. SCADA systems must be equipped to handle the increasing size and scope of emerging systems.
With the power of RTAP's real-time object database, considerable engineering hours and system downtime can be avoided throughout the lifecycle of large-scale automation systems - from development through expansion and maintenance. RTAP's database offers the following benefits:
- Manage your assets more effectively by organizing the database into objects that model the hierarchy of your physical operations.
- Eliminate repetitive steps involved in modeling hundreds of similar components within your operations by copying and reusing database objects, full database branches and graphical objects throughout the system.
- Drastically improve the scalability of your system through the use and management of groups of objects called classes. Individual modifications made to a class affect all members or instances of that class, avoiding the need to modify individual system components.
- Save significant time in the development of the operator interface. Through the powerful concept of relative addressing, common graphic diagrams and control panels once created, can then be animated by whatever object in the database that is referenced at the time.
- Flexibly model any kind of application through complete control over the structure of the basic systems building block - the database object. For example the database object could represent:
- Physical entities of varying complexity, such as pressure transducers, fractionation columns, or pump stations
- Calculated entities like KPIs such as power output or plant efficiency
- Application support entities, such as recipes or batch records
Leveraging these benefits not only reduces the lifecycle cost in the SCADA system, by making it easier, more flexible and more efficient to work with, it also increases the overall reliability and effectiveness of your operations.
The database also provides benefits through the following components:
Calculation Engine
Like a spreadsheet, the event driven calculation engine (CE) is used to handle a wide range of computation problems, without programming. The CE is similar in concept to a spreadsheet in that definitions can be associated among any values in the database. It automatically updates derived values whenever raw data is acquired - whether from the scan system, an operator entry, or an application. In addition to a library of base CE functions provided with RTAP, developers can also write any type of industry specific function they require.
Alarm System
RTAP provides a powerful and extensible alarm mechanism that can be tailored to meet the most demanding detection, filtering, notification and logging requirements. A user-friendly alarm display front end integrates directly into HMI panels and is fully configurable.
Long Term Historian
The RTAP Historian allows you to create a long-term, time series history record for any value in the database. Sampling can be time or event driven and optional dead banding can be used to filter out minor changes. The storage capacity is limited only by the size of your disk. Although stored on disk, history files are accessed through the real-time database and are an extension to its object structure.
RTAP Environment Services
In providing leading flexibility to manage demanding SCADA systems, RTAP environments can be optimized per machine for each unique application or purpose. RTAP supports distributed systems cost-effectively. An RTAP environment can be a modular group of cooperating processes and shared resources or it can be a full-fledged automation system, communicating with other environments, other computers, other software packages, and other parts of your business. An RTAP event manager can watch for triggers from RTAP and other applications and will then initiate real-time follow on activities within in entire SCADA system.
RTAP Redundancy
Living up to an established reputation for superior reliability RTAP comes with various features to ensure downtime is virtually nonexistent, especially in large complex systems where reliability is sometimes a challenge. A complete packaged redundancy solution is available with RTAP. The RTAP redundancy solution provides bumpless failover of HMI clients and the ability to have multiple hot standby database servers. Standby servers are instantly synchronized so that there is no loss of data during changeover. Standby servers can also be controlled for trial or test purposes before going back online.
